Форум программистов, компьютерный форум CyberForum.ru

Составить программу, которая заполняет квадратную матрицу -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 ) http://www.cyberforum.ru/cpp-beginners/thread166684.html
#include <cstdlib> #include <iostream> #include <stdio.h> #include <math.h> using namespace std; int main() { system ("chcp 1251") double x,y; double a=100, b=0.001,rez;
C++ Функция Нужно написать ф-цию которая упорядоченный массив выводит в случайном порядке? Не могу понять алгоритм перестановки элементов??? Вот что у меня получилось: #include <windows.h> #include <iostream> #include<time.h> #include<stdlib.h> using namespace std; http://www.cyberforum.ru/cpp-beginners/thread166660.html
C++ С клавиатуры вводится текстовая строка на русском языке. Найдите количество гласных и согласных букв.
С клавиатуры вводится текстовая строка на русском языке. Найдите количество гласных и согласных букв. Используйте фильтр для ввода только текстовых символов. Помогите никак не могу сделать.
Решения без директивы #define C++
Вот сама задача: Написать программу которая выводит таблицу значений функции y=-2.4*x*x +5*x-3 в диапазоне от -2 до 2 с шагом 0.5. вот решение: #include <iostream> #include <iomanip> using namespace std; #define LB -2.0 #define HB 2.0
C++ Одномерный массив http://www.cyberforum.ru/cpp-beginners/thread166629.html
Помогите пож кому не сложно. В одномерном массиве, состоящем из N вещественных элементов, вычислить: 1)Произведение положительных элементов массива 2)Сумму элементов массива, расположенных до минимального элемента Упорядочить по возрастанию отдельно элементы, состоящие на четных местах, и элементы, стоящие на нечетных местах.
C++ Для каждого массива определить минимальный по модулю элемент даны вещественные массивы a b для каждого массива определить минимальный по модулю элемент и количество положительных элементов массива расположенных за ним #include <stdio.h> // Подключение внешних файлов(библиотек) #include <math.h> #include<conio.h> #include <iostream> using namespace std; // Пространство имен int main... подробнее

Показать сообщение отдельно
Хохол
Эксперт C++
 Аватар для Хохол
475 / 443 / 13
Регистрация: 20.11.2009
Сообщений: 1,292
17.09.2010, 17:13     Составить программу, которая заполняет квадратную матрицу
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
#include <iostream>
 
using namespace std;
 
const int dx[] = {0,1,0,-1};
const int dy[] = {1,0,-1,0};
int a[100][100];
 
int main()
{
    int n;
    cout << "Enter n: ";
    cin >> n;
    for(int i = 1; i <= n; i++)
    {
        a[0][i] = -1;
        a[i][0] = -1;
        a[n+1][i] = -1;
        a[i][n+1] = -1;
    }
    int x = 1, y = 1, d = 0;
    for(int i = 1; i <= n*n; i++)
    {
        a[x][y] = i;
        if(a[x+dx[d]][y+dy[d]] != 0)
            d = (d+1)%4;
        x += dx[d];
        y += dy[d];
    }
    for(int i = 1; i <= n; i++)
    {
        for(int j = 1; j <= n; j++)
            cout << a[i][j] << '    ';
        cout << endl;
    }
    system("pause");
}
 
Текущее время: 02:43.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ru